You can exit an individual open position directly from the Positions tab in FYERS. This helps you close a specific position without affecting your other open positions.
FYERS App
- Open the FYERS App.
- Go to Portfolio from the bottom navigation.
- Open the Positions tab.
- Tap the position you want to exit.
- The position details screen will open.
- Tap Quick exit.
- The order panel will open with the opposite order side.
- Review the symbol, product type, quantity, order type, funds, and charges.
- Modify the quantity if you want to exit only part of the position.
- Tap the exit order button, such as Sell Qty or Buy Qty, depending on the position side.
After the order is executed, FYERS displays an order confirmation with details such as symbol, product, side, quantity, order type, and processing time.
FYERS Web
- Open FYERS Web.
- Go to Portfolio from the top navigation.
- Open the Positions tab.
- Hover over the position you want to exit.
- Open the position action menu.
- Select the exit option for that position.
- The order panel will open with the opposite order side.
- Review the symbol, product type, quantity, order type, funds required, funds available, and charges.
- Modify the quantity if you want to exit only part of the position.
- Click the exit order button, such as Sell Qty or Buy Qty, depending on the position side.
Once the order is executed, FYERS Web shows a confirmation message, such as Sell order for [symbol name] [quantity] quantity executed successfully.
What if...
| Scenario | Solution |
|---|
| Partial exit | Change the quantity in the order panel before submitting the exit order. |
| Exit option not visible | Ensure you are viewing an active position in the Positions tab. The option will not apply to Holdings or already closed positions. |
| Order not executed | Check the market status, order type, price, and available liquidity for the selected symbol. |
| Position still visible after exit | The position may remain visible if the order is pending, partially executed, or only part of the quantity was exited. |
